Transaction f23c2d140bf0582e95de1596e9a17d2b72f7b8365156d1a624160fc9bf30ed12

1 Input
2 Outputs
  • f23c2d140bf0582e95de1596e9a17d2b72f7b8365156d1a624160fc9bf30ed12:0
  • value  50000000
    address  386koexPdMMFVAbwCoCgtatfFPfxeJg3Hh
  • f23c2d140bf0582e95de1596e9a17d2b72f7b8365156d1a624160fc9bf30ed12:1
  • value  848979084
    address  3BF7HhbKQE3tapjowGs5GKgFZfQAddHXLB